Position Overview:
Keystone Custom Homes is seeking an Assistant Counsel to support the General Counsel and the Vice President of Land and Counsel in providing legal guidance and services across all aspects of our residential homebuilding and land development operations. This role will work closely with the General Counsel, the Vice President of Land and Counsel and the executive leadership to help manage legal risk, ensure regulatory compliance, support business operations, support land acquisition and development efforts and contribute to the company's continued growth and success. The Assistant Counsel will handle and assist with a broad range of legal matters including, but not limited to, contract review and drafting, corporate governance, real estate transactions, zoning and land use, customer disputes, regulatory compliance and litigation.
